Is Modern Dentistry Painless?
This question tops the list for anxious patients. Thanks to technological advancements, the answer is increasingly yes. Modern Dentistry for Dental Anxiety incorporates numerous innovations that minimize discomfort significantly.
For instance, Needle-Free Anesthesia options are now available for patients who dread injections. Additionally, Computerized Anesthesia Delivery (Wand) systems provide precise, controlled numbing that feels like gentle pressure rather than a painful shot. These systems work slowly and steadily, allowing the anesthetic to take effect without the traditional sting.
Furthermore, Quiet Drills have replaced the loud, nerve-wracking equipment of the past. Modern handpieces operate almost silently, eliminating one of the most anxiety-inducing aspects of dental procedures. As a result, patients can relax without the psychological trigger of drilling noise.

Sedation Options for Nervous Patients
Modern Dentistry for Dental Anxiety recognizes that one size doesn’t fit all. Therefore, Dental Avenue Hospital offers various Sedation Options for Nervous Patients tailored to individual comfort levels.
Nitrous oxide (laughing gas) provides mild relaxation while keeping you fully conscious. Meanwhile, oral sedation helps moderate to severe anxiety sufferers feel calm throughout their procedure. For extremely anxious patients, IV sedation offers deeper relaxation under professional monitoring.
Dental Anxiety Medication can also be prescribed before appointments to ease anticipatory stress. Our experienced team will discuss these options during your consultation, ensuring you feel confident about your choice.

Q2: How does computerized anesthesia delivery reduce pain compared to traditional injections?
Computerized Anesthesia Delivery (Wand) controls the flow rate and pressure of anesthesia automatically, delivering medication slowly and steadily. This minimizes tissue distension and discomfort, making the numbing process virtually painless compared to traditional manual injections.
